Global firm ADM expands, opens feed mill in Cotabato

Ehda M. Dagooc - The Freeman

CEBU, Philippines —  American animal nutrition provider ADM announced its expansion ventures in Southern Philippines, with acquisition of a feed mill in Polomolok, South Cotabato—South Sunrays Milling Corporation.

The South Cotabato mill, along with existing ADM feed production facilities in Cebu and Bulacan, support customer growth in the region with a wide range of leading-edge pet food, complete feed, aquaculture and premix solutions, said Gerald Wilflingseder, president, Animal Nutrition, Asia Pacific, at ADM.

According to Wilflingseder, this investment will support economic development through the creation of more than 100 new jobs in the region.

“We are excited to combine our global expertise with deep local insights to unlock greater value for our customers in the Philippines and across the region,” said Lorenzo Mapua, managing director, Animal Nutrition, Philippines, at ADM.

“This acquisition will allow us to offer a wide range of high-quality feed products for swine, poultry and aqua for both backyard and commercial farm segments with our recognized brands such as Ultrapak, Evialis and Ocialis,” Mapua explained.

On April 11, 2017, South Sunrays Milling Corporation (SSMC) ventured into the feeds manufacturing business and started the feeds tolling business in South Cotabato Province, Philippines. Its first client is the leading hog and poultry raiser in Mindanao, BIOTECH FARMS INC, where requirements reached 5,000 metric tons of feeds monthly. After three years, SSMC expanded

 its second feed mill to produce quality feeds for Aqua, Pet foods and extruded raw materials like full-fat soya & other raw materials. One of their milestones includes venturing into Aqua (shrimp) farming in Sarangani Province, Philippines under a new corporation, South Sunrays Aqua Ventures Corporation.
